IT Support Analyst

Sorry, this advert is now closed. Click here to view our live vacancies.

A successful global engineering firm is seeking an IT Support Analyst to support the technology requirements of end-users and their software, hardware, and communications technology throughout their European sites. The role is also involved in regional server support, network support and vendor management.

 

Responsibilities include:

  • Monitoring ICT Service Request and Incident queues and responding based on ITIL processes and company SLAs.
  • Resolve end-user requirements within the office and remotely, including hardware and software support.
  • Coordination with our Infrastructure Managed Service Provider in the support of regional servers and networks.
  • Local and regional procurement and vendor management, liaising with vendors on application and hardware related issues.
  • Support and troubleshooting of local AV and Teams equipment.
  • Perform application installation, removal, configuration, and updates.
  • IT onboarding of employees using defined standards and processes. 
  • Technical/engineering software license monitoring, compliance and support.
  • Maintaining and creating technical documentation and knowledge base articles.
  • Assist in responding to and remediating any Severity 1 ICT issues affecting all or part of the organisation. 
  • Working closely with the ICT team to support project work.
  • Administration and Troubleshooting of Office 365 applications including Teams, SharePoint Online and Exchange Online.
  • Contributing to Continual Service Improvement, Service Reporting and Service Measurement.
  • Any other items reasonably requested by the ICT Service Delivery Manager.
  • Project support work around GDPR/ Data privacy (so an understanding of UK/EU regulations is a big plus).

 

Qualifications, Skills & Experience

 

  • Ideally you’ll have experience of all of the above
  • Engineering sector experience preferred 
  • Understanding of, or qualifications in ITIL service framework
  • Introduction to Azure Fundamentals training.
  • A minimum of 5 years’ experience resolving end user computing hardware and software issues both onsite and remotely.
  • Supporting Microsoft technologies including Windows 10 operating system, Office 365 applications and Active Directory.

 

Salary:
£50,000
Type:
Permanent
Location:
London - Central
Sector:
IT Support
Ref:
18364
Contact Name:
Will Cusack

Latest IT Support Jobs

Infrastructure Engineer - Camberley - £36,000pa

Surrey / £36,000pa

An academy based in Camberley are looking for an Infrastructure Engineer to join the team. This is a newly created role within the organisation and would also suit candidates who have previously worked as a Network Engineer or Network Manager. Please note, this role will be fully site based (no hybrid or remote working). They...

Read more

IT Technician

London - Central / £30,000

A well-known TV Production Company seeking an IT Support Technician to help provide 1 st support to users within the group. This role is based in London and supports multiple group locations in London ensuring systems are maintained and supported to the highest standards. This is the perfect role to progress in time into a...

Read more

IT Helpdesk Analyst

London - Central / £27,000

A global creative agency based in Central London is seeking a capable IT Helpdesk Analyst to join the team on a permanent basis. This role incorporates hybrid working so you’re able to work from home twice per week. Reporting into the Head of IT, the successful candidate will be responsible for providing 1 st and...

Read more
View more

Exclusive roles, straight to your inbox

Not all our jobs make it online. Sign up for Job Alerts and receive our best roles first.